Finding Open-Source Solutions for Linux

To explore the many open-source applications available for Linux, go to the SourceForge.net Web site at http://source forge.net. SourceForge.net hosts thousands of open-source projects not only for Linux, but for other OSs as well, including Windows. For Linux-and UNIX-specific pointers to open-source projects, also visit freshmeat at http://www.freshmeat.net. In recent years, freshmeat has become a great place to find open-source solutions for your project.
